sql >> Database teknologi >  >> RDS >> Mysql

Vælg procentdel af rækker fra SQL-tabel?

Du kan COUNT alle poster, og beregn derefter % du har brug for sådan her:

$query = "SELECT COUNT(*) FROM `Flight_Data` WHERE DepDateTimeUTC LIKE '%1/1/14%' ";
$result = mysqli_query($connection,$query);
$row = mysqli_fetch_row($result));

$total = $row[0];
$percent = intval($total * 0.40);

$query = "SELECT * FROM `Flight_Data` WHERE DepDateTimeUTC LIKE '%1/1/14%' LIMIT ". $percent;
//execute your query....


  1. SQL:Brug kun stort første bogstav

  2. Brug OBJECTPROPERTY() til at finde ud af, om en tabel er en systemtabel i SQL Server

  3. MySQL JOIN returnerer NULL-felter

  4. Hvordan går jeg gennem mysql-resultatsættet i fatfree framework?